Article Overview

After fusion splicing, optical fibers should be carefully placed into splice trays, secured with protective sleeves, and organized within the ODF to ensure low-loss, safe, and durable connections.

Step 1: Protect the Fusion Splice

Once the fibers are fused, slide a heat-shrink splice sleeve over the splice point and shrink it using a heat source or the splicer's built-in heater. This protects the splice from mechanical stress and environmental factors, preventing microbends or breakage during handling and reassembly .

Step 2: Place Fibers in Splice Trays

  • Open the splice tray in the ODF.
  • Carefully lay the spliced fibers into the tray's routing channels, following the tray's bend radius guidelines (typically >30 mm) to avoid stress on the fiber .
  • Use the tray's fiber clips or holders to secure the fibers, ensuring the splice sleeve sits in the designated splice holder to prevent movement .

Step 3: Organize and Route Fibers

  • Route the fibers neatly along the tray's channels, avoiding sharp bends or crossing fibers.
  • Maintain minimum bend radius for both the incoming and outgoing fibers to prevent attenuation or breakage.
  • If multiple fibers are spliced, organize them in layers or loops according to the tray design, keeping fibers separated to simplify future maintenance .

Step 4: Close and Secure the Splice Tray

  • Once all fibers are properly routed and secured, close the splice tray cover.
  • Ensure the tray is locked or latched to prevent accidental opening.
  • Place the tray back into the ODF rack, aligning it with the designated slot and securing it with screws or clips as required .

Step 5: Test and Verify

  • After reassembly, perform optical testing using an OTDR or power meter to verify splice integrity and ensure no additional loss occurred during handling .
  • Label the fibers and trays clearly for future identification and maintenance.

Best Practices

  • Always handle fibers with care, avoiding tension or contact with sharp edges.
  • Keep the workspace clean and free of dust or debris to prevent contamination of splice points .
  • Follow manufacturer guidelines for splice trays and ODF installation to maintain warranty and performance standards. By following these steps, your fusion-spliced fibers will be securely reassembled in the ODF, maintaining optimal performance and protecting the delicate splices from mechanical or environmental damage .
